[Subtitle 1: East Lake Scenic Area]
East Lake Scenic Area is the largest urban lake in Wuhan and a national 5A-level scenic spot. It has beautiful lakes and mountains, as well as rich cultural and historical relics. When visiting East Lake, you can stroll along the lakeside, enjoy the scenery of the lake and mountains, and breathe in the fresh air. In addition, you can also visit the East Lake Greenway, cycle or walk along the lakeside, and feel the beauty of nature.
[Subtitle 2: Yellow Crane Tower]
The Yellow Crane Tower is one of the famous ancient buildings in China and an iconic attraction in Wuhan. The Yellow Crane Tower is located on the south bank of the Yangtze River in Wuhan. It is the place where the famous ancient Chinese literature "Yellow Crane Tower Sends Meng Haoran to Guangling" was written. Climbing the Yellow Crane Tower, you can overlook the beautiful scenery of the entire Wuhan city and enjoy the magnificent scenery of the Yangtze River. Here, you can also learn about the profoundness of ancient Chinese culture.
[Subtitle 3: Hubu Lane]
Hubu Lane is one of the oldest neighborhoods in Wuhan First, it is also one of the best preserved architectural communities of the Ming and Qing Dynasties. There is a strong historical atmosphere here, and the streets are lined with antique buildings, making people feel like they have traveled through time. In Hubu Lane, you can taste authentic Wuhan snacks, buy unique handicrafts, and visit the museum to learn more about the history of Wuhan.
